The Mechanics of Elevating Cranberry Juice

So, what exactly are these simple swaps that are revolutionizing the world of cranberry juice? The answer lies in a few key ingredients and techniques that can transform this classic drink into a refreshing and revitalizing beverage. Here are some of the most popular swaps:

  • Infusing cranberry juice with fruits like pineapple, orange, or grapefruit for added flavor and nutritional value.
  • Using alternative sweeteners like honey, maple syrup, or coconut sugar to reduce sugar content and add unique flavors.
  • Adding spices like cinnamon, nutmeg, or ginger to create a warm and comforting flavor profile.
  • Using probiotics or other gut-friendly ingredients to support digestive health.

Addressing Common Curiosities

Infusing cranberry juice with fruit is a great way to add natural sweetness and flavor without resorting to added sugars. Simply add your choice of fruit to the juice and let it steep in the refrigerator for a few hours. As for alternative sweeteners, most can be used in small amounts to add a hint of sweetness without overpowering the flavor of the juice. Probiotics and other gut-friendly ingredients can be added to support digestive health, but be sure to follow the manufacturer’s instructions for use.

Finally, making your own elevated cranberry juice at home is easy and fun. Simply combine your chosen ingredients in a large pitcher and stir well. Adjust the sweetness and flavor to taste, and enjoy your delicious homemade cranberry juice.
